RAM has its own rough and tumble off-road truck called the Power Wagon, and the pricing for the 2017 models has been unveiled. RAM’s beast starts at a higher price than the Raptor at $53,015.

That is an increase of $1,155 over the outgoing model. It should have decent off-road chops with Bilstein shocks, five-link rear coil springs, and 33-inch tires stock. It even gets a Warn winch in the bumper, skidplates, and tow hooks. It’s got a 6.4L Hemi, with 410hp and 429 lb-ft. of torque, it’s got some good power, but still 40 hp and 81 lb-ft. shy of the almost certainly lighter weight competition from Ford.

The only options for the truck include a $4,495 leather and luxury package. Apparently, you can add much of the Power Wagon equipment to the 4×4 flavor of the 2500 Tradesman for $8,450, making that starting price $48,315, $10 less than the Raptor. I’ll be all Raptor all day at these prices.
